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
173082 96116550 860 16928253
285597 62807 302288379
285597 62807 302288379
9641749 322159075 97573
All about undefined
Interested in learning more?
285597 62807 302288379
9641749 322159075 97573
See more
102 799856
40426294 340919218 8980 64237945 93397557521
See more
0263 84094 776764545
179077 59 28
See more